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bali Shortcake | fennec |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Cnidaria (Cnidarians)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Anthozoa |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Scleractinia (Scleractinia) | Carnivora (Carnivorans) |
| Family | Acroporidae |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) |
| Genus | Acropora | Vulpes (Foxes) |
| Species | Acropora latistella | Vulpes zerda |
